Wholesale Market Company Hit by Ransomware, Farmer Shipping Data at Risk
A server at a wholesale market company in Seoul’s Gangseo Market was hit by a ransomware attack, temporarily disrupting the auction system and settlement operations. Authorities restored essential services using backup data and rebuilt a new server, while experts warned that farmer transaction information remains at risk and requires a thorough investigation. #GarakCo #GangseoMarket

Keypoints

  • A server belonging to a wholesale market company at Gangseo Market in Seoul was infected by ransomware.
  • The attack temporarily disabled the auction system and settlement operations.
  • Essential services were restored, but the transaction information inquiry service remained unstable until June 22.
  • Authorities used backup data to build a new server and immediately blocked the network to prevent further spread.
  • Experts warned that such attacks are becoming more sophisticated with AI assistance.
  • Officials were urged to conduct a thorough investigation to protect farmers’ data.
